GRAHOVAC v. MUNISING TP.

Docket No. 248352.

689 N.W.2d 498 (2004)

263 Mich. App. 589

Lisa GRAHOVAC, Personal Representative of the Estate of Paul Bryan Grahovac,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. MUNISING TOWNSHIP and Richard Allan Fromm, Defendants, and Harold Anderson, Defendant-Appellant.

Court of Appeals of Michigan.

Decided September 21, 2004, at 9:05 a.m.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Petrucelli & Petrucelli, P.C. (by Vincent R. Petrucelli and Jonny L. Waara), Iron River, for Lisa Grahovac.

Smith Haughey Rice & Roegge (by Lance R. Mather), Grand Rapids, for defendants Munising Township and Harold Anderson.

Vairo, Mechlin, Tomasi, Johnson & Manchester (by David R. Mechlin), Houghton, for Richard A. Fromm.

Before: WHITBECK, C.J., and GRIFFIN and BORRELLO, JJ.


BORRELLO, J.

In this wrongful death action, defendant Harold Anderson,1 the chief of the Munising Township volunteer fire department, appeals as of right the trial court's order denying his motion for summary disposition under MCR 2.116(C)(7). Because we agree with the trial court that a township fire chief2 is not sheltered by the absolute immunity provisions of MCL 691.1407(5), we affirm.
